Tindersticks ready for U.S. return
It may have taken a while - five years to be exact - but the Tindersticks are finally read to return to North America. In support of its recently released seventh studio album, The Hungry Saw, the legendary British outfit composed of founding members Stuart Staples, David Boulter, and Neil Fraser along with the new rhythm section of Dan McKinna, Thomas Belhom, Terry Edwards, and Andrew Nice will make their first live performances in the U.S. and Canada since 2006 beginning next March.
So far, the Tindersticks have unveiled seven stops, kicking off on March 4th in Philadelphia, though more are likely to be announced in the coming weeks.
The band reformed in 2007 following a lengthy hiatus, in which during frontman Stuart Staples embarked on what proved to be a fairly successful solo career.
